Understanding Grams and Ounces



Before diving into the conversion, let's clarify the units involved. Grams (g) and ounces (oz) are both units of mass or weight. The gram is a metric unit, part of the International System of Units (SI), while the ounce is a unit in the imperial and US customary systems. The key difference lies in their base units and scaling: the gram is based on the kilogram (the SI base unit for mass), while the ounce is derived from the pound. This inherent difference necessitates a conversion factor to move between the two systems.

The Conversion Factor: Grams to Ounces



The conversion factor between grams and ounces is approximately 28.35 grams per ounce. This means that one ounce is equal to 28.35 grams. To convert grams to ounces, we divide the number of grams by the conversion factor.

Therefore, to find out how many ounces are in 500 grams, we perform the following calculation:

500 grams / 28.35 grams/ounce ≈ 17.64 ounces

Therefore, 500 grams is approximately equal to 17.64 ounces.

Precision and Rounding



It's important to note that the conversion we used (17.64 ounces) is an approximation. The exact conversion depends on the level of precision required. For most practical purposes, rounding to two decimal places (17.64 ounces) is sufficient. However, in scientific applications or situations requiring high accuracy, using more decimal places or a more precise conversion factor might be necessary.

Beyond 500 Grams: A General Approach



The method described above can be applied to convert any weight in grams to ounces. Simply divide the weight in grams by 28.35. Conversely, to convert ounces to grams, multiply the weight in ounces by 28.35.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)



1. Is the conversion factor 28.35 grams per ounce exact? No, it's an approximation. The exact conversion factor is 28.3495231 grams per ounce, but 28.35 is sufficiently accurate for most purposes.

2. Can I use an online converter for gram to ounce conversions? Yes, many online converters are readily available and provide quick and accurate results.

3. What if I need to convert kilograms to ounces? First, convert kilograms to grams (1 kg = 1000 g), then use the conversion factor 28.35 g/oz.

4. Are there any other units of weight I should know about? Yes, other units include pounds (lb), kilograms (kg), milligrams (mg), and tonnes (t).

5. What is the difference between mass and weight? Mass is the amount of matter in an object, while weight is the force of gravity acting on that mass. While often used interchangeably, they are distinct concepts. The conversions discussed here pertain to mass.
